95 Grand Am won't start
Okay, here it is. I have a 95 Grand Am that wont start. We have tried replacing the sending unit for the fuel pump twice now. No go. We have replaced the relay switch for the fuel pump, still no go.
Has anyone had this issue with their Grand Am before? My ex that is currently trying to get this thing running for me tells me it definately has to be something with the fuel pump, maybe electrical. We dumped a little gas into the carburator and it started up for a short second. So, it is not receiving gas for some reason. Any ideas? If you need more information let me know and I can ask my ex. My car knowledge is very limited.Thanks for any assistance! I want my car back! sosmith Indiana |

Re: 95 Grand Am won't start
Welcome. Try the fuel pump fuse and the fuel pressure regulator. Sounds like something is not getting a signal to the pump, or the regulator is bad and not allowing fuel into the injectors. There is something else, but I can't think of it right now. Anyone else have ideas? I'm thinking crank position sensor, not sure if that would be the cause or not (gotta love those 60 hour work weeks).

Re: 95 Grand Am won't start
put a test light on the fuel pump terminal to see if you have power there while cranking the engine. If theres power try a fuel pressure gauge. Could be a bad pump or clugged filter.
